ARNE AMBITION CAN BE PAIN IN NECK FOR CONTINENTAL RIVALS

ARNE Engels enjoyed stuffing Newcastle into the Parkhead hurt locker at the weekend.
And it's given the Belgian a taste for inflicting more pain in the Champions League.
The Hoops are still a work in progress in preseason but the confidence levels are soaring after sparkling displays in defeating Sporting Lisbon and the Magpies without conceding.
Eddie Howe's Newcastle brought 10,000 fans north on Saturday - and they expected to see their Champions League-bound English Premier League giants give Celtic a sore one.
Instead they were sent home in shock by a lethal 4-0 win from Brendan Rodgers' Bhoys in the inaugural Adidas Trophy.
Seeing off top qualify opposition has only whetted the appetite for Engels - and he's keen to make sure Celtic make the big time when the qualifying playoff arrives next month.
The midfielder - who notched from the spot against the Magpies - said: "That's a big goal, to reach the Champions League.
"In a few weeks, there are really big games coming up.
"It's up to us to now get physically ready for that. I'm sure we'll do great in those games.
